WebCephas was known by several names in the Bible. Although his original name was Simon, he is also known as Peter in the Bible. His name in the Bible, Cephas, comes from the Aramaic word cephas, which means stone, pebble, or character. As a disciple of Christ, Peter had a lot of influence on the Church and had a significant role in its growth. WebIn John 1:42 Jesus called Peter as Cephas. Jesus looked at him and said, “You are Simon son of John. You will be called Cephas” (which, when translated, is Peter). WebCephas. a Syriac surname given by Christ to Simon ( John 1:42), meaning "rock." The Greeks translated it by Petros, and the Latins by Petrus. These dictionary topics are from M.G. …
